Thanks. However, you can be bottlenecked by a component to a certain degree, it doesn't have to be complete. It could also mean, that you start to be seriously gpu bottlenecked at roughly 130fps and BD only reaches this mark with tweaking. To analyze this, you would have to do one of two things:

a) overclock sandy further. if the fps rise (almost) 1:1 with the clock increase, you are indeed cpu bound. If not, there is your limit, that now both cpus hit
b) overclock your 6990. if the fps rise, you are gpu bound.

Sorry, but so far it is not conclusive. Also, is it DX9 or DX11?
